Assessment Process
The process of getting an ADHD assessment may differ between providers. In general, you will be required to complete questionnaires on your symptoms, as well as your family's history of mental illness. You will be asked about your general health and how your conditions affect different aspects of your daily life. These questions can be quite personal, which is why it's crucial to feel comfortable around the psychiatrist who is assessing you.
It is not uncommon for the assessment to be conducted by video conference. Bring a photo ID you to the appointment. Be prepared to answer questions regarding your personal and professional life and also your childhood. It is also worth considering making a list of symptoms you are experiencing and examples of how they affect your day-to-day life.
You will receive an written report from your psychiatrist which will be used to diagnose ADHD. The report will include a summary and recommendations for treatment. They might also recommend a shared-care agreement with your GP for the prescription medication.
Once you have received your diagnosis, you will be eligible to claim disability benefits like Disabled Students Allowance and reasonable adjustments at work. In addition, you will be able to ask for assistance from your GP to receive psychological support and self-help strategies.
Some have complained of long wait times for their local NHS services, and some CCGs have been accused of not funding assessments under Right to Choose. However, GPs and CCGs are becoming more aware of this option, and are increasing their use of it to cut down the time it takes to complete NHS funded ADHD assessments.
It is important to remember that even if you pay for your private ADHD assessment The healthcare provider must follow national guidelines and standard. Some providers do not adhere to the standards. The BBC's Panorama program highlighted a number clinics that gave out unreliable diagnosis without due process. While this vigilance is important but we must not forget the fact that many people are in desperate need of the support they can receive from a diagnosis and a treatment program for their condition.

Private clinics are accused of prescribing powerful medications and diagnosing patients too rapidly. Panorama, a BBC investigation, questioned hundreds of patients and whistleblowers, including former employees at the Harley Psychiatrists clinic and ADHD Direct. They were told that appointments were sporadic and that nearly all patients were given a diagnosis of ADHD. Clinics deny it however, the report reveals that some patients received improper treatment.
